Description

  • Simon Hantai
  • ³M.C.2² (mariale)
  • signed, titled and dated 1962
  • oil and gouache on canvas
  • 209 by 219cm.; 82 1/4 by 86 1/4 in.

Provenance

Galerie Kléber, Paris
Acquired directly from the above by Willem Sandberg for the Peter Stuyvesant Collection in 1964

Exhibited

Paris, Musée du Louvre, Le Musée dans l'Usine, Collection Peter Stuyvesant, 1966
Quebec, Museum (& travelling), Art in the Factory / Le Musée dans l'Usine, 1968-1969
Sankt Gallen, Kunstmuseum (& travelling), Le Musée dans l' Usine, 1970-1971
The Hague, Pulchri Studio, Peter Stuyvesant Collectie, 1972
Tilburg, Kultureel Centrum, Peter Stuyvesant Collectie, 1979
Arsac en Médoc, Château d'Arsac (& travelling), Aventure dans l'Art, Collection Peter Stuyvesant, 1989
Zevenaar, Turmac, 30 Jaar Peter Stuyvesant Collectie: Hommage à Spinoza, 1990
Amsterdam, Stedelijk Museum, Art Works: International Modern Art in the Industrial Working Environment, an Experiment over more than Thirty Years: Peter Stuyvesant Foundation, 1991-1992, p. 93, illustrated in colour
Barcelona, Fondación Miró; Zaragoza, Palacio de la Lonja; Valencia, Museo de la Ciudad, El Arte Funciona, 1992
Paris, École Nationale Supérieure des Beaux Arts, l'Art Actif, 1992
Jouy-en-Josas, Fondation Cartier, Azur, 1993

Condition

Colours: The colours in the catalogue illustration are fairly accurate, although the overall tonality is deeper and richer in the original work which has more aquamarine hues most notably to the centre of the composition. Condition: This work is in very good condition. There are scattered unobtrusive surface irregularities which would appear to be original to the work’s execution. Close inspection reveals unobtrusive networks of stable craquelures at the centre of the composition and in several other areas below this in the lower left quadrant. No restoration is apparent when examined under ultraviolet light.
